Each Release in MusicBrainz has a unique ReleaseID, which is an absolute URI. It has the form http://musicbrainz.org/release/UUID, where UUID is a Universally Unique Identifier in its 36 character ASCII representation. In situations where the context is clear (such as file tags), just the UUID part can be used, leaving a relative URI.

Example

The ReleaseID http://musicbrainz.org/release/1138abc1-77f4-4ba9-900d-5cf52baaf4bf is a unique identifier for the release Desire. 1138abc1-77f4-4ba9-900d-5cf52baaf4bf is a relative URI for this release.
